The first shipments of the COVID-19 vaccine arrived in First Nations in Manitoba.

Pimicikamak Cree Nation, Norway House, Fisher River Cree Nation, and Peguis First Nation were the first to receive COVID-19 Moderna vaccine doses. These Nations were prioritized due to the presence of personal care homes and/or elder homes within the community.
